About Chy Kensa
Chy Kensa is a two-bedroom semi-detached house in St. Columb Road, St. Columb, St Columb (TR9 6QA). It has a recorded floor area of 61 m² (around 657 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1991-1995 and council tax band B. The latest certificate (March 2025) shows a D (score 55), a step below the typical UK home. When first surveyed in December 2023 the rating was E,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, roof efficiency went from Good to Very Good, window efficiency went from Average to Good and hot-water efficiency went from Very Poor to Poor.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 74). Main heating runs on lpg.
At 61 m² it sits well below the postcode median (102 m² across 8 EPCs), making it one of the more compact homes locally. Across 2014–2024, sale prices on this property compounded at 3.9%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£194,000 is 21.2% above the 2024 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£244/sq ft) was about 67.6%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Last sale on file: £160,000 in September 2024.
